Psychiatric Urgent Care for Children & Adults
Walk-in appointments for children and adults who need mental health services, including psychiatric evaluation and assessment, addiction medicine, crisis services and community resources. Patients under 18 years of age must have a parent or guardian with them.

Emergency Departments in Cedar Rapids
If a loved one is experiencing a mental health crisis: have a plan to act on their suicidal, homicidal or self-harm thoughts, & you feel as if the current environment is unsafe, utilize the emergency room. The emergency room is used to stabilize and transition a person to the next appropriate treatment option.
